Avalanche Skills Training 2 + Managing Avalanche Terrain

AST 2 + MAT is where terrain judgement stops being a feeling and starts being a repeatable process. It builds directly on AST 1, running on the same Avalanche Canada curriculum, and takes you from following a plan to building one.

Over five days — one classroom day and four in the field — you’ll work through advanced routefinding, the ATES technical model for rating terrain yourself, using the Avaluator as a filtering tool rather than a checklist, and running a proficient companion rescue under pressure, not just a textbook one.

This is a genuine step up from AST 1, not a repeat of it with more field days bolted on.

Prerequisites

Completion of AST 1 (or equivalent) is required before enrolling.

You’ll need to have completed AST 1 + CSR (or an equivalent recognised course) and have a moderate amount of backcountry experience behind you — this course assumes you already know how to use your rescue gear and are comfortable moving through avalanche terrain, and builds from there.

Course Curriculum

1

Day 1: Classroom
  • Advanced terrain evaluation theory
  • The ATES technical model
  • Avaluator as a filtering tool

2–5

Days 2–5: Field
  • Advanced routefinding and risk mitigation
  • Danger rating verification in the field
  • Proficient companion rescue under realistic conditions
  • Understanding your own training limitations
